Constrained interaction testing: A systematic literature study

BS Ahmed, KZ Zamli, W Afzal, M Bures - IEEE Access, 2017 - ieeexplore.ieee.org
Interaction testing can be used to effectively detect faults that are otherwise difficult to find by
other testing techniques. However, in practice, the input configurations of software systems …

Achievement of minimized combinatorial test suite for configuration-aware software functional testing using the cuckoo search algorithm

BS Ahmed, TS Abdulsamad, MY Potrus - Information and Software …, 2015 - Elsevier
Context Software has become an innovative solution nowadays for many applications and
methods in science and engineering. Ensuring the quality and correctness of software is …

Locating errors using ELAs, covering arrays, and adaptive testing algorithms

C Martínez, L Moura, D Panario, B Stevens - SIAM Journal on Discrete …, 2010 - SIAM
In this paper, we define and study error locating arrays (ELAs), which can be used in
software testing for locating faulty interactions among parameters or components in a …

[PDF][PDF] Constructing a t-way interaction test suite using the particle swarm optimization approach

BS Ahmed, KZ Zamli, CP Lim - International Journal of Innovative …, 2012 - academia.edu
This paper presents the design and implementation of a new t-way test generation strategy,
known as the Particle Swarm Test Generator (PSTG). Complementing the existing work on t …

[PDF][PDF] A harmony search based pairwise sampling strategy for combinatorial testing

ARA Alsewari, KZ Zamli - International Journal of the Physical …, 2012 - academicjournals.org
Over the years, we become increasingly dependent on software in many activities of our
lives. To ensure software quality and reliability, many combinations of possible input …

Optimal overlap** tomography

K Hansenne, R Qu, LT Weinbrenner, C de Gois… - arxiv preprint arxiv …, 2024 - arxiv.org
Characterising large scale quantum systems is central for fundamental physics as well as for
applications of quantum technologies. While a full characterisation requires exponentially …

A survey of constrained combinatorial testing

H Wu, C Nie, J Petke, Y Jia, M Harman - arxiv preprint arxiv:1908.02480, 2019 - arxiv.org
Combinatorial Testing (CT) is a potentially powerful testing technique, whereas its failure
revealing ability might be dramatically reduced if it fails to handle constraints in an adequate …

An empirical study of real-world variability bugs detected by variability-oblivious tools

A Mordahl, J Oh, U Koc, S Wei, P Gazzillo - … of the 2019 27th ACM Joint …, 2019 - dl.acm.org
Many critical software systems developed in C utilize compile-time configurability. The many
possible configurations of this software make bug detection through static analysis difficult …

Combinatorial test list generation based on Harmony Search Algorithm

ARA Alsewari, R Poston, KZ Zamli, M Balfaqih… - Journal of Ambient …, 2022 - Springer
Combinatorial test case generation faces a problem on how to reduce the test cases by
uncover the unnecessary test cases. So, there is a need for expert applications or strategies …

Chip: A configurable hybrid parallel covering array constructor

H Mercan, C Yilmaz, K Kaya - IEEE Transactions on Software …, 2018 - ieeexplore.ieee.org
We present a configurable, hybrid, and parallel covering array constructor, called CHiP.
CHiP is parallel in that it utilizes vast amount of parallelism provided by graphics processing …